AI-based Customization

Today, micro-coaching leverages data to tailor to users’ individual needs. The data to be analyzed can range from fitness levels to goals and targets to progress already achieved to create a unique roadmap for each user. The dynamic adjustments to the athletes’ programs ensure the puppy’s efficacy.

AI can provide real-time advice that goes well beyond tracking. For example, if an app notices a decrease in progress, it modifies the intensity or recommends recovery tactics. Such a high level of customization could only be extended by expensive trainers. But now, everyone has access to a program that feels tailor-made.

Wearable Sensors

Wearables and apps complement one another to provide athletes with detailed information. Devices such as smartwatches and fitness trackers monitor statistics such as calories burned, steps walked, and heart rate. Apps process this information and convert the derived numbers into actionable feedback.

With this strategy, feedback during workouts is available at once. Picture being informed in the middle of a run whether you ought to work harder or ease off for maximum yields.

Accessibility and Affordability

Athletes on tight budgets would benefit significantly from micro-coaching applications. Traditional coaching can easily exceed hundreds of dollars monthly and is inaccessible to most. These applications level the playing field by providing affordable personalized coaching and, in some cases, no-cost basic plans for everyone.

Cost is not the lone factor to consider, as accessibility is unmatched. Athletes can work out anytime, anywhere, incorporating practice into their hectic schedules. They only need a smartphone to receive professional tips on the performance tools that analyze and track their progress. These apps allow consumers to self-direct their fitness journeys, making good coaching accessible.
